OPSO gears up for C.S.I. summer camp
by Scott Rogers - posted E-mail Story E-mail Story | Print Story Print Story 
Beginning next month, the Ouachita Parish Sheriff's Office will offer a two-day summer Crime Scene Investigation camp for local youth.

For the past three summers, the sheriff's office, along with the Monroe Police Department and the West Monroe Police Department, facilitated a one-week cadet academy for local youth.

Last year, Ouachita Parish Sheriff Royce Toney wanted to do something extra for local youth who had shown an interest in learning about police investigations, according to OPSO's Marky Tucker.
